#4d8c04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d8c04 is composed of 30.2% red, 54.9%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.1%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 87.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 28.2%. #4d8c04 color hex could be obtained by blending #9aff08 with #001900.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#4d8c04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d8c04 has RGB values of R:77, G:140,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 5082116.

Shades and Tints of #4d8c04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040700 is the darkest color, while #f9fff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d8c04
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484a46 is the less saturated color, while #4d8c04 is the most saturated one.
